Guidance for Selecting Music Inspired by the Animated Film for Dance Fitness

Considerations when choosing musical selections intended for a Zumba routine influenced by themes found in a children’s film are diverse. The following points provide direction for optimizing the overall fitness experience.

Tip 1: Tempo Consistency: Prioritize songs with a BPM (beats per minute) suitable for sustained aerobic activity. Generally, a range of 130-145 BPM proves effective for maintaining a moderate to vigorous workout intensity.

Tip 2: Genre Diversification: Incorporate a range of musical genres that align with the thematic elements of the film. While high-energy pop and electronic dance music are standard choices, explore incorporating genres that mirror the films setting or cultural influences.

Tip 3: Instrumentation Variety: Seek tracks that utilize a diverse range of instruments. This helps maintain auditory interest and prevents listener fatigue, particularly during longer workout sessions.

Tip 4: Lyrical Appropriateness: Carefully review lyrical content to ensure suitability for all participants. Given the source material’s target audience, prioritize tracks with positive, non-offensive themes.

Tip 5: Structured Transitions: Ensure smooth transitions between songs. Abrupt changes in tempo or genre can disrupt the flow of the routine and negatively impact the workout experience. Utilize DJ software or pre-mixed playlists to ensure seamless transitions.

Tip 6: Licensed Music Compliance: Confirm that any publicly performed music is appropriately licensed. Adherence to copyright laws is crucial, particularly when leading group fitness classes.

Tip 7: Audience Customization: Adapt the music selection to the preferences and fitness levels of the participant group. Consider surveying participants beforehand to gauge their musical tastes and adjust the playlist accordingly.

5. Energetic Tempo Selection

5. Energetic Tempo Selection, Song

The viability of integrating musical elements related to a particular animated film into a dance fitness format like Zumba hinges critically on energetic tempo selection. Music drawn directly from film scores, or inspired by them, often lacks the consistent, elevated beats per minute (BPM) necessary for sustained aerobic activity. Film music serves primarily a narrative function, supporting emotional arcs and cinematic pacing, whereas dance fitness music prioritizes rhythmic consistency and high energy output.

The process involves either selecting pre-existing songs with tempos appropriate for Zumba (typically 130-145 BPM) and then tailoring the choreography to align with those selections, or adapting existing film music through remixing or re-composition. Direct application of film music without modification would likely result in an uneven and ineffective workout experience, marked by fluctuations in intensity and potential disruptions to the flow of movement. For example, a dramatic orchestral piece with shifting time signatures, while emotionally resonant, would be unsuitable for a sustained Zumba routine. Frequently Asked Questions

This section addresses common queries regarding the integration of “Cars 3” thematics and music within a Zumba fitness context. The information presented clarifies potential misconceptions and provides factual insights.

Question 1: Does an officially licensed “Cars 3” Zumba program exist?

As of the current date, there is no evidence to suggest the existence of an officially licensed Zumba program directly affiliated with the “Cars 3” film franchise. Individual instructors may create routines inspired by the film, but these are not endorsed or sanctioned by Disney or Zumba Fitness, LLC.

Question 2: Where can one locate music suitable for a “Cars 3”-themed Zumba class?

Suitable music may be found through various channels, including commercial music streaming services, online music stores, and independent music producers. Tracks that align with the film’s energetic tone, such as high-tempo pop, electronic dance music, or Latin rhythms, are commonly selected. Remixes of tracks from the film’s official soundtrack may also be utilized.

Question 3: Are there legal considerations when using copyrighted music in a public Zumba class?

Yes, the public performance of copyrighted music requires appropriate licensing. Fitness instructors must secure licenses from performing rights organizations (PROs) such as ASCAP, BMI, and SESAC to legally play copyrighted music in a commercial setting. Failure to obtain these licenses can result in legal action.

Question 4: What tempo range is most effective for a “Cars 3”-inspired Zumba routine?

A tempo range between 130 and 145 beats per minute (BPM) is generally considered optimal for a Zumba class. This range provides sufficient energy for cardiovascular activity while allowing for clear and synchronized movements. Adaptations may be necessary based on the participants’ fitness levels and choreographic complexity.

Question 5: How can one ensure thematic relevance in a “Cars 3” Zumba class?

Thematic relevance can be achieved through strategic music selection, choreographic choices, and visual elements. Incorporating instrumental cues from the film’s soundtrack, designing movements that reflect character traits, and utilizing “Cars 3”-themed visuals (e.g., projected images or costumes) can enhance the thematic connection.

Question 6: Is it appropriate to include dialogue excerpts from the film in a Zumba class?

While brief dialogue excerpts may be incorporated for thematic effect, prolonged use of dialogue can disrupt the flow of the workout and detract from the musical rhythm. Careful consideration should be given to the length and placement of any dialogue excerpts to maintain a balanced and effective fitness experience.
